Exodus 29:30-45 Holy Bible: Easy-To-Read Version (ETR)

30. Aaron’s son will become the next high priest after him. That son will wear these clothes seven days when he comes to the Meeting Tent to serve in the Holy Place.

31. “Cook the meat from the ram that was used to make Aaron the high priest. Cook that meat in a holy place.

32. Then Aaron and his sons must eat the meat at the front door of the Meeting Tent. And they must also eat the bread that is in the basket.

33. These offerings were used to take away their sins when they were made priests. Now they should eat these offerings.

34. If any of the meat from that ram or any of the bread is left the next morning, then it must be burned. You must not eat that bread or the meat because it should be eaten only in a special way at a special time.

35. “You must do all these things for Aaron and his sons. You must do them exactly as I told you. The ceremony for appointing them to be priests must continue for seven days.

36. You must kill one bull every day for seven days. This will be an offering for the sins of Aaron and his sons. You will use these sacrifices to make the altar pure, and pour olive oil on the altar to make it holy.

37. You will make the altar pure and holy for seven days. At that time the altar will be most holy. Anything that touches the altar will also be holy.

38. “Every day you must make an offering on the altar. You must kill two lambs that are one year old.

39. Offer one lamb in the morning and the other in the evening.

40-41. When you kill the first lamb, also offer 8 cups of fine wheat flour. Mix that flour with 1 quart of the best oil. Also offer 1 quart of wine as an offering. When you kill the second lamb in the evening, also offer the 8 cups of fine flour mixed with 1 quart of the best oil and offer 1 quart of wine. This is the same as you did in the morning. This will be a sweet-smelling gift to the Lord. When you burn this offering, he will smell it, and it will please him.

42. “You must burn these things as an offering to the Lord every day. Do this at the entrance of the Meeting Tent before the Lord. Continue to do this for all time. When you make the offering, I will meet you there and speak to you.

43. I will meet with the Israelites at that place, and my Glory will make that place holy.

44. “So I will make the Meeting Tent and the altar holy. I will also make Aaron and his sons holy so that they can serve me as priests.

45. I will live with the Israelites. I will be their God.
